memorabilia
plural noun souvenirs of people or events.
[19c: Latin, meaning -memorable things-]

memorable
adjective worth remembering; easily remembered; remarkable.
[15c: from Latin memorabilis , from memorare to remember]
memorability noun .
memorably adverb .

memorandum
noun (memorandums or memoranda )
1 a written statement or record, especially one circulated for the attention of colleagues at work.
2 a note of something to be remembered.
3 law a brief note of some transaction, recording the terms, etc.
[15c: Latin, meaning -a thing to be remembered-, from memorare to remember]

memorial
noun
1 a thing that honours or commemorates a person or an event, eg a statue or monument.
2 (esp memorials) hist a written statement of facts; a record.
adjective
1 serving to preserve the memory of a person or an event a memorial fund .
2 relating to or involving memory.
[14c: from Latin memoriale reminder]

Memorial Day
noun in the USA: a national holiday held on the last Monday in May in honour of American war dead.
